Secaucus Fireworks Will Be July 1 This Year, At Town Pool

SECAUCUS, NJ — Secaucus Mayor Mike Gonnelli and the town council invite residents to the town's annual Independence Day celebration, held at 6 p.m. July 1 this year, as always at the town pool.
There will be free food, entertainment, games and fireworks that go off when it gets dark.
Open only to Secaucus residents and their guests. You must show ID to enter the Secaucus Swim Club.
